Among the key updates of threat-informed remediation on Rapid7’s Command Platform:
- Unified Vulnerability Management Across Ecosystems: Rapid7 continues to expand support for third-party vulnerabilities, helping organisations consolidate and act on risk signals across disparate security tools. With vendor-agnostic dashboards, reporting, and centralised workflows, security teams can now prioritise vulnerabilities across their entire ecosystem, streamline remediation, and track progress with confidence.
- Fully Integrated Automation into the Remediation Process: Security teams can use Remediation Hub workflows to automate asset owner notifications and manual tasks. This reduces administrative overhead, improves communication efficiency, speeds up remediation and offers a unified progress view to comprehensively track remediation across hybrid environments.
- Transparent, Trustworthy AI-Powered Triage: This new triage experience in Rapid7’s AI detection and response platform, InsightIDR, gives security analysts unprecedented visibility into the decisions made by the Rapid7 AI Engine. A redesigned alert details interface highlights the key data inputs and reasoning behind each AI-driven triage decision, helping teams build trust and seamlessly integrate automation into their workflows. The new “AI Suggested Disposition” field enables faster investigation and resolution by allowing users to sort, filter, and bulk action alerts triaged by AI.
- Active Remediation With Velociraptor: Once a threat is contained, the work shouldn’t stop there. With this new capability of Velociraptor, Rapid7 now performs advanced remediation actions on customers’ behalf, removing malware remnants, restoring registry settings, and returning affected assets to a secure state. This reduces dwell time and helps organisations bounce back faster, often before they’ve had time to react manually.
- Breach Protection Warranty: In addition to the enhancements around AI-triage and remediation with Velociraptor, Managed Threat Complete (MTC) Ultimate customers can now confidently manage the financial impact of a cyberattack with up to USD $1,000,000 in breach-related coverage embedded directly into the service. This includes expenses related to forensic investigations, legal counsel, post-incident response, and public relations. In addition, Rapid7’s service is the only offering to include unlimited incident response (IR), removing the cost of IR engagements required by other providers. With the financial benefit not offset by additional fees, customers reduce complexity in breach response planning.
